The answer to 'flashing hail damage' is that hail can cause significant damage to roof flashing, which are the metal strips used to seal the joints and edges of a roof. Common symptoms of hail damage to flashing include dents, cracks, and tears. This can lead to leaks and water intrusion if not addressed properly.
The best solution depends on the extent of the damage. For minor dents or small cracks, you may be able to perform basic flashing repairs yourself, such as using a flashing sealant or replacing small sections. However, for more extensive damage, it's best to call a professional roofing contractor to inspect the flashing and make necessary repairs or replacements. They have the expertise and tools to properly address hail-related flashing issues and ensure your roof remains watertight.
